Hundreds of volunteers came together at Place Ville-Marie in Montreal on Saturday to admire 344 knitted and crocheted blankets made by other volunteers from across the province to help women in needAlong the floor, it was a cushy, immense kaleidoscope of colour - all created by hand. The project is called “Crafted for Courage” and was organized by the Nota Bene Foundation. The community-driven art initiative is by women - for women. “We have hundreds of volunteers,” said founder Nori Bortoluzzi.

In Ville Saint-Laurent, a group of strangers became friends when they decided to help a stranded animal. A cat stuck high up in a tree for more than a day seemed to be in trouble — until neighbours decided to reach out. Gabrielle Lacoste said, “He just looked very distressed. And we spoke to our neighbour, and he had been up there for over 24 hours.” So, she started knocking on doors along Sainte-Croix Avenueasking for help from neighbours she hadn’t known.

As the warmer weather arrives, plenty of people are taking their bike out for a ride. While wearing a helmet while riding is recommended, it’s not a law — though some think it should be. Dominic Roussel knows from experience how helpful a helmet is. He was recently “doored” when a driver opened their car just as he was cycling by. “I smashed through the window, through the frame and rolled and got up and my adrenaline was surging and roaring!” says Roussel.

They say it’s a North American first. The Maison Rose offers free care for people fighting breast cancer — the most prevalent cancer among women in this province, according to the Quebec Breast Cancer Foundation. This new care centre is their initiative, says president and CEO Karine-Iseult Ippersiel.

There is good news for seniors on Montreal’s West Island who need a hot meal delivered to their door. “Volunteer West Island” has a new central kitchen to cook for their Meals on Wheels program. Cooking up a storm in the new kitchen, Chef Mark Straughton said the new central kitchen offers a recipe for success. “It’s fantastic,” he said. “Brand new, sparkling, shiny, everything. It turns on when you want it to turn on.
